Job - Assistant to Grants Manager, American University of Armenia

Publish Date: Nov 03, 2016

Deadline: Nov 30, 2016

Company: American University of Armenia (AUA), Administration

Position: Assistant to Grants Manager

Contract type: FT (5 days/40 hours per week)

Job Location:  Yerevan, Armenia

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Assist the Grants Manager in developing, managing, delivering and promoting the Foundation’s grants program;
  • Participate in sharing and planning meetings to discuss and address issues related to the AUA Grants program implementation;
  • Assist in the provision of technical and logistical support in the grants search, identification and application process to ensure that the process is smooth and in compliance with various policies, financial guidelines and budget requirements of the university;
  • Work closely with the Grants Manager to strategize and operationalize the grants streams supportive of the AUA strategic vision and program objectives;
  • Assist in the overall grant process, including monitoring and data gathering, tracking, and documentation;
  • Work closely with accounting office staff in the process of gathering required documentation of transactions/activities related to grants.
  • Assist in the development of and maintains a database of grantors, including a tracking system that provides frequent updates on funding calls, reporting requirements, audits, contract deliverables and budget revisions.
  • Assist the Manager in the preparation and writing of progress and annual reports, annual work plans, status reports and other documents that may be requested by the Assistant Vice-President.
  • Is responsible for making arrangements related to workshops, meetings, presentations and workshops related to grant programs, as requested.
  • Perform related duties as assigned by the immediate supervisor.

REQUIREMENTS:

  • Master's degree in relevant field (public policy, administration, management, etc.).
  • Minimum experience of two years in the relevant field.
  • Superior writing and communication skills; ability to structure reports appropriately.
  • Ability to work well in a team environment, handle multiple assignments and meet deadlines.
  •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ail.
  • Knowledge of fundraising sources, basic fundraising techniques and strategies.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ment.
